Description
QUALIFICATION REQUIREMENTS: Level 3 or above in a full and relevant childcare qualification. Purple Dove Recruitment are currently looking for enthusiastic and passionate Level 3 Nursery Nurses for an independent family owned nursery in Banstead. The nursery pride themselves on creating an atmosphere of happiness. Salary: • Nursery Nurses (Level 3) - paying up to£31,000 per annum (Depending on experience) Hours: • 42.5 hours per week, over 5 days • 38 hours per week, over 4 days Benefits include: • 28 days annual leave PLUS additional days at Christmas • Annual pay reviews • Regular team events • Parent partnership events • Funded qualifications and training opportunities • £100 refer a friend scheme • Regular support from management • Discounted childcare The role: • Working as a key person to build strong relationships with both children and their families. • Planning stimulating and fun activities whilst closely following the Early Years curriculum. • Observing children and recording early years milestone. • Be a good role model to the children. • Encouraging learning through meaningful play. • Working to maintain Health & Safety and Safeguarding Practices within the setting. • Creating a fun, safe and warm environment where children can flourish and grow. • To attend out of working hours activities, to include training, staff meetings, parents evenings and special events. • To be involved in team planning appropriate activities to ensure that the children’s developmental needs are met. • To contribute to the observation and assessment of the children’s developmental stages, recording this on the relevant documents. • To work flexibly as part of the larger nursery team, assisting and supporting colleagues wherever required in order to ensure the smooth running of the nursery. Candidate: • An Early Years/childcare qualification Level 3 or above. • Excellent written and spoken English communication skills. • A passion for childcare and a full understanding of the EYFS.
